3D Rendering Market sees traction in industrial prototyping

The global 3D rendering market size was estimated at USD 4.21 billion in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 19.82 billion by 2033, expanding at a CAGR of 19.2% from 2025 to 2033.

The rapid advancement of cloud computing continues to propel market growth, as cloud-based rendering solutions offer unmatched scalability, processing speed, and cost efficiency. This enables organizations to manage complex rendering projects without significant investments in on-premise infrastructure.

Key Market Trends & Insights

  • North America accounted for 35.6% of global revenue in 2024.
  • In the U.S., increasing adoption of rendering solutions in the education and healthcare sectors is contributing significantly to market expansion. Educational institutions are enhancing STEM programs, while hospitals and researchers use 3D rendering for surgical planning, diagnostics, and patient communication.
  • By component, the software segment captured 77.0% of revenue in 2024.
  • By operating system, Windows dominated market share in 2024.
  • By application, product design led with a 25.3% revenue share in 2024.

The adoption of AI and cloud technologies is significantly transforming the 3D rendering landscape. AI-enabled rendering engines can automate lighting adjustments, refine textures, and improve scene optimization, reducing manual workloads and enabling faster design iterations. Cloud infrastructure further enhances performance by offering virtually unlimited computing resources, making high-end rendering more affordable and accessible. A notable example is Autodesk’s acquisition of Wonder Dynamics in May 2024, adding the AI-powered Wonder Studio platform to its offerings and enabling seamless integration with tools like Autodesk Maya for advanced animation and VFX creation.

Key 3D Rendering Company Insights

Major industry players such as Adobe Inc.; Advanced Micro Devices Inc.; and Autodesk Inc. focus on product innovation, partnerships, and strategic collaborations to strengthen their market presence.

  • August 2025: Autodesk Inc. introduced a new pricing model for Autodesk Flow Studio, leveraging AI to simplify complex VFX workflows including motion capture, character animation, and scene compositing.
  • July 2025: Chaos Software EOOD acquired EvolveLAB, integrating BIM automation with real-time visualization across the Chaos ecosystem.
  • June 2025: PTC Inc. partnered with NVIDIA to embed Omniverse technology into Creo CAD and Windchill PLM, improving real-time simulation, photorealistic visualization, and digital-twin-driven collaboration.
